Trump warns Putin of 'severe consequences' if the war continues

FILE - President Donald Trump, right, meets with Russian President Vladimir Putin on the sidelines of the G-20 summit in Osaka, Japan, June 28, 2019. Source: AAP / Susan Walsh/AP
Donald Trump has warned of ‘severe consequences’ if Vladimir Putin blocks peace in Ukraine, while also suggesting Friday’s Alaska meeting could be followed by a second summit that includes Volodymyr Zelenskyy. But there are already signs the Russian leader’s not in the mood for compromise and President Zelenskyy has warned Putin is ‘bluffing’. European leaders, who had feared the American President could sell out Ukraine, now say they’re confident he will push for a ceasefire.
